GREYMOUTH.

January 5 In the Hack Race at Ahaura to-day ten started. Fairy, with R, Barton riding, fell when five or six ohaina from the atartiag post. Barton was in the aot of rising, having a hold of the bridle, when another horso came up knooking or kioking him over.' He was seen to roll over, but never rose afterwards. He was carried to the booth, aud remained nnconscioua for some time, but after a while ho spoke. Death ensued four hours {afterwards, apparently without pain. He was unoonsoious at the last. Deceased, who was a resident of Hokitika, leaves a wife and family.
